Srirangapatna Temple Idol of Lord Vishnu in sleeping posture under the hood of the great snake Anantha in this 1200 year old temple. 8:00 – 9:30 am 
7:00 – 8:00 pm
Open on all days 20 minutes 9:15 am Free entry
Tipu Palace – Daria Daulat Bagh Tippu memorabilia in the Palace Museum on the top floor. 
Beautiful Frescoes on the walls of the palace.
“Storming of Srirangapattanam” painting by Sir Robert Porter (1800 AD)
9:00 am – 5:00 pm Open on all days 30 minutes 10:15 am Rs.5 for Indians & Rs.100 for Foreigners
Bird Sanctuary 
(alternative to Srirangapatna Temple & Palace)
Migratory Birds from Siberia to Australia, which come here every year. Boat Ride Rs.25/person, will take you around the islets for closer views of the birds & nests. Best time to visit: June to December. 8:30 am – 6:00 pm Open on all days 45 – 60 minutes 10:30 am Rs.20 for Indians, Rs.60 for Foreigners.
Chamundi Temple, Chamundi Hills 16 ft tall & 25 ft long monolith statue of Nandi – Lord Shiva’s vehicle.
15 kg solid gold idol of Goddess Chamundeshwari in the Temple.
Mahisasura statue.
7:30 am – 2:00 pm 
3:30 – 9:00 pm
Open on all days 45 minutes 12:15 pm Free entry
Mysore Palace 750kg golden Howda, Diwan-e-khas & aam, Royal Portraits & wall Paintings, Kalyana Mantapa, Wrestling Courtyard & Old Palace model. 
Audio Tour Guide: Rs.150 for Indians, Rs.250 for Foreigners. 
Palace Lighting: 7:00 – 7:45 pm on Sundays & Public holidays. 
Light Show: 7:00 – 8:00 pm (closed on Sundays & Public Holidays), Entry Rs.40/Adult; Rs.25/Child. 
Maharaja Living Quarters (Entry Rs.5/person)
10:00 am – 5:30 pm. Closed during Dasara Festival (Oct) 60 – 90 minutes 2:00 pm Rs.40 for Indians & Rs.200 for Foreigners

Zoo View the rare animals from across the world. Eg: 3 species of Rhinos and Tigers. Book Mysore Zoo entry tickets online to avoid long queues.
View the zoo in a battery powered cart. Rs.100/Adult, Rs.50/Child.
8:30 am to 5:30 pm Tuesday Holiday 90–120 minutes 6:00 pm Rs.40 / Adult,
Rs.20 / child
Jaganmohan Palace (alternative to Zoo) Paintings of Raja Ravi Varma and Svetoslav Roerich.
Watch the parade of miniature soldiers every hour on the French Clock. 
8:30 am to 5:30 pm Closed during Dasara Festival (Oct) 60 minutes 6:00 pm Rs.25 / adult &
Rs.10 / child
KRS Dam – Brindavan Gardens Manicured Gardens with colourful fountains. 
Fountain timings are 7:00 – 7:55 pm weekdays.  7:00 – 8:55 pm on weekends and holidays.
Musical Fountain – timings are Week Days 6:30 pm – 7:30 pm. Weekends 6:30 pm – 8.30 pm
10:00 am – 8:00 pm Open on all days 60 – 90 minutes 8:30 pm Rs.15/person
